Xenophobia IS NOT the same as racism.

The most commonly accepted definitions of xenophibia are :

1: An exaggerated or abnormal fear of strangers or foreigners.

2: A strong antipathy or aversion to strangers or foreigners.

Similar to, for example, an Englishman (stereotypically white) with an irrational hatred of the French ( also stereotypically white) simply for not being English. Race has nothing to do with it.

In a 40K context, this translates as " I'm Imperial, you're not, so COME GET SOME "
